Why Replica Hermès Bags Are a Bad Buy
Replica bags imitate luxury designs without permission. They look similar from a distance, but the details fall apart up close. Stitching is uneven. Hardware feels light and flakes. Leather cracks. The smell of cheap glue lingers. More important, selling counterfeits is a federal crime in the US. Customs officers seize replica shipments. Buyers can face packages being destroyed and, in some cases, legal penalties. You also have no recourse if the bag arrives damaged or never arrives at all.
Quality That Does Not Last
Authentic Hermès bags are hand-stitched by trained artisans using premium leathers. A replica might use plastic-based faux leather or split-grain leather that peels within months. Zippers stick. Logos are printed crooked. The shape collapses. You end up replacing the bag soon, which costs more over time than saving for a pre-owned original.
Legal and Ethical Problems
Counterfeiting is not a victimless crime. It steals revenue from designers, supports unsafe factories, and sometimes funds smuggling networks. When you buy a replica, you take on that risk. You also break the law in many places. The safer path is to buy authentic or choose a brand that makes similar styles without copying trademarks.
What to Look For in a Legitimate Bag
If you love the Hermès look, you can buy authentic pre-owned bags from reputable resellers. Here is what to check.
- Authentication: Look for a certificate from a trusted authenticator. Brands like The RealReal and Fashionphile employ experts.
- Condition: Pre-owned bags are graded. Check for scratches, corner wear, and strap cracks. Ask for detailed photos.
- Provenance: Request the original receipt, dust bag, box, and rain cover. Missing items lower value.
- Leather type: Hermès uses Togo, Epsom, Clemence, and Swift. Each has a distinct grain and feel. Learn the differences.
- Hardware: Gold or palladium plating should feel solid. It should not flake or show copper underneath.
- Stitching: Saddle stitching is done by hand at an angle. Machine stitching is a red flag for authenticity.
Parameter Bands for Buying Pre-Owned Hermès
You can set realistic expectations with these ranges.
- Price: A pre-owned Birkin or Kelly usually starts in the thousands of dollars. A replica might cost a few hundred, but it has no resale value. Save that money toward a real bag.
- Size: Popular sizes for women include 25cm, 30cm, and 35cm. A 25cm works for evening, while a 30cm is a daily bag.
- Age: Bags from the 1990s and 2000s can be excellent values. Check for spa treatment records from Hermès.
- Color: Neutrals like black, gold, and etoupe hold value best. Bright colors are more seasonal.
Pitfalls to Avoid
Do not buy from social media ads that promise "1:1 replica" quality. Those sellers disappear after payment. Do not trust a low price from an unknown website. Do not buy a bag without third-party authentication. Do not assume a replica will pass as real. People who know luxury goods can spot a fake from across a room. Finally, do not ignore the law. Buying counterfeit goods can lead to fines and seized packages.
FAQ
Are replica Hermès bags legal to buy for personal use?
In the US, buying counterfeit goods is illegal under trademark law. Customs can seize the item. You could face civil penalties. It is not worth the risk.
Can I find a high-quality replica that looks real?
No replica matches the craftsmanship of an authentic Hermès bag. Some come close in photos, but they fail in person. You will not fool an expert.
What is a good alternative to a replica Hermès bag?
Buy a pre-owned authentic bag from a certified reseller. Or look at mid-range brands that make original designs, such as Polène, Strathberry, or Cuyana. They offer quality without copying trademarks.
How do I authenticate a pre-owned Hermès bag?
Use a professional authentication service like Bababebi or Entrupy. They examine stamps, stitching, hardware, and leather. Never rely on a seller's word alone.
